Never quite understood the S4 cabriolet. I guess if you need one car to do everything it makes sense but it's a real boat. The S4 sedan and avant are completely different and make more "sense" to me. I was on the fence about an S4 for quite some time and drove a whole bunch of them, fast and AWD but the gearbox is garbage and the clutch is from another planet. Since I have the S2k for nice weather, I decided on the A4 3.0 ultrasport over the S4 and have been very happy. Drive the Boxster S if you want a replacement for the S2k. Great clutch, gearbox, handling and torque! The Caymen is a hard sell without a sunroof for me, even if handling is better than the Boxster. Actually, the Boxster S is a bargain when you consider it now has the same engine as the Caymen and costs about $6,000 less (instead of $6,000 more for a convertible vs hardtop). Just a thought. Hiro
